Jasper County Democrat, Volume 22, Number 1, Rensselaer, Jasper County, 2 April 1919 — ALBERT J. KNIP A SUICIDE [ARTICLE]

ALBERT J. KNIP A SUICIDE

Demotte Barber Ends Life With a Revolver Sunday Morning. Coroner W. J. Wright was called to Demotte Sunday and again. Monday to investigate the suicide of Albert J. Kntp, the Demotte barber, who ended his life Sunday''morning by shooting himself through the heart. The evidence showed that Knip had worked late the night before and that he and his wife had gotten up quite late Sunday morning, both suffering from a severe headache. Knip remarked they might better both be dead and, going on out to the kitchen, pulled from his pocket a revolver —which he always carried —and shot himself through the heart. Deceased was about 40 years of age and leaves a wife but no children. except a step-son, who is now in the army service. Knip served in the Spanish-American war .and was in the regular army for a number of years. He was a big, jolly fellow and it is surprising to his friends that he should have done tliis rash act. The funeral was held at Demotte yesterday afternoon, at 2 o’clock and burial made in the Demotte cemetery.
